Ditch Repair in Atlanta, GA
Ditch repair services focus on restoring and maintaining underground drainage systems that direct water away from a property’s foundation, landscaping, and other structures. These projects typically include fixing or replacing damaged or collapsed pipes, addressing blockages, and ensuring proper slope and alignment to prevent water pooling or flooding. Homeowners often request ditch repairs after noticing persistent water drainage issues, erosion, or signs of pipe damage such as sinkholes, foul odors, or pooling water in the yard.
Before requesting ditch repair services,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the damage, the type of piping used, and the best approach for repairs or replacement. It’s also helpful to know if any excavation or land grading is necessary to ensure proper water flow. Clarifying the scope of work and any potential disruptions can assist in planning the project effectively and avoiding future drainage problems.

Ditch Repair Questions
What types of ditch repair services are available? Services include fixing collapsed or damaged ditches, restoring proper drainage, and repairing erosion issues to protect property foundations.
When should a ditch be repaired? Repairs are needed when signs of erosion, standing water, or structural damage appear, affecting drainage or property stability.
What causes ditch damage? Common causes include heavy rainfall, poor initial installation, soil erosion, and root intrusion from nearby vegetation.
How can property owners maintain their ditches? Regular inspections, removing debris, and addressing minor erosion early can help maintain proper drainage and prevent costly repairs.
